Friday events, Feb. 27
There’s some good music for a good cause happening at Backspace Friday night. Five bands, including Dana Louise, Witchsister, RAT BRATS, Llinda, and C-Rex (Springfield, MO) will perform beginning at 9 a.m., and all the proceeds from the event go to the NWA Rape Crisis Center. Admission is $5.
Also in music, Mike Shirkey has a show at the Fayetteville Underground with Steve Fisher, Ed Carr, and Dennis Collins, the Australian Bee Gees are at the WAC, local country band Backroad Anthem is at George’s, reggae band Rochelle Brandshaw & Hypnotion is at Smoke & Barrel, and there’s a rock show at The Lightbulb Club with Pagiins and Hydrogen Child.

Saturday events, Feb. 28
The chili cookoff we mentioned earlier this week is Saturday morning at the Fayetteville Town Center. It’s called Chilirha, it starts at noon, and proceeds benefit local Alzheimer’s research.
There’s an interesting sounding experimental theatre show playing this weekend at The Nines called Tender Comrades. Here’s a bit more info.
Music wise, punk-rock karaoke company Karaoke Underground is at The Lightbulb Club (sing your favorite underground songs), The Inner Party will celebrate their CD release at Ryleigh’s with The Good Fear, and blue grassers Mountain Sprout and Arkansauce are at George’s.

Sunday events, March 1
Maxine’s has their popular music/interview show Singled Out this week, with performances and interviews by locals West Street Blues Band hosted by local songwriter Adam Cox. It starts at 7 p.m., and there’s no cover.
There’s also a rare Sunday night folk show at JR’s Lightbulb Club with songwriter Ken Gaines. It starts early at 7 p.m.
